Facilities

Secunderabad has a number of passenger facilities, including modern security and parking. A coach depot for cleaning and maintenance is next to the station. The area around the station is sometimes congested. The station has restaurants, cafes, a coffee shop, book stalls, waiting and cloak rooms, a cyber cafe, tourism agents' and train-inquiry counters, digital train-status boards, train-status announcements and foot bridges. A pharmacy has a dispensary and first-aid kit. Three waiting rooms are at the station's north entrance, and two are at the south entrance. An
air-conditioned Air conditioning, often abbreviated as A/C (US) or air con (UK), is the process of removing heat from an enclosed space to achieve a more comfortable interior temperature, and in some cases, also controlling the humidity of internal air. Air c ...
waiting room is on platform 1, and a non-air-conditioned dormitory is on the first floor. The air-conditioned waiting room is free of charge for passengers with air-conditioned-class tickets. Preservationists fear that the massive upgrade may leave the heritage building a memory of a bygone era, since 85 million has already been spent on station improvements. A series of meetings was convened with Railway Board authorities in July 2009. It was decided to hire a consultant to sketch a master plan for the project, including facilities to be incorporated, a time frame and estimated cost. Global tenders for consultants were issued on 26 September, and the successful bidder (who would have ten months to propose a master plan) would be selected on 30 October. The
request for tender An invitation to tender (ITT, also known as a call for bids or a request for tenders) is a formal, structured procedure for generating competing offers from different potential suppliers or contractors looking to obtain an award of business activ ...
deadline was extended to 24 December and then indefinitely, due to a lack of bidders.

This scheme, formulated on the back of the insights and recommendations from a high-level committee, aims to address the practical difficulties experienced with the Manual of Standards and Specifications for Railway Stations (MSSR 2009) issued in June 2009. The committee's mandate included reviewing and updating the MSSR 2009, devising measures for optimising the redevelopment costs of stations, and establishing norms for the scale of facilities to be provided at redeveloped stations. Under the umbrella of the Indian Railways' Major Upgradation initiative, the redevelopment of Secunderabad Railway Station is one of the key projects identified. With a budget allocation of Rs. 720 crores, the project seeks to transform the station into an iconic structure that provides world-class amenities. The Prime Minister, Narendra Modi, laid the foundation stone for this monumental redevelopment on 8 April 2023, signifying the start of a project that aims to culminate by the end of 2025. The redevelopment project boasts several salient features aimed at enhancing the travel experience: * Iconic Station Building: Designed with a future horizon of 40–60 years, the station will serve as a landmark with its aesthetic and functional design. * Future-Proof Facilities: The project plans for an extended horizon, ensuring facilities are in place to manage a peak hour traffic of 25,000 passengers and accommodate surges up to 325,000 passengers during special events like Melas. * Expansion of Station Building Area: The proposed station building area is significantly expanded to 61,912 sqm from the existing 11,427 sqm, facilitating a broader range of services and amenities. * Spacious Roof Plaza/Concourse: Measuring 108m x 120m, this double-level area will host all passenger amenities, alongside retail spaces, cafeterias, and recreational facilities, effectively connecting both sides of the station and all platforms. * Integration and Accessibility: Ensuring seamless integration of both city sides and improved accessibility with 26 lifts, 2 travelators, and 32 escalators. * Enhanced Passenger Experience: The project focuses on segregating arriving and departing passengers, decluttering platforms, and providing comprehensive facilities for the differently-abled. * Direct Connectivity: Enhancements include direct connectivity to the East & West Metro Stations and Rathifile Bus Station, fostering an integrated transport hub. * Multilevel Car Parking and Segregation: To further streamline the passenger experience, the project introduces multilevel car parking at the North Terminal. This feature, along with the strategic segregation of arriving and departing passengers, optimises flow and convenience. * Sustainability and Safety: The station will feature certified green buildings, solar energy utilisation, water conservation/recycling, comprehensive CCTV coverage, and access control for enhanced safety.
